    This is your typical Chinese buffet, but I noticed heavily focused on seafood (fried crab, boiled and fried shrimp, fried fish, crawfish, etc). Not such a bad thing if you enjoy seafood, but even if you don't, they still have your typical Chinese buffet options (general Tso, pepper beef broccoli, fried rice, etc.). Note - we went during a weekend lunch, so other times and days may vary (not sure). We went there with a low expectation because of all the mixed reviews, but we were both impressed. I enjoyed the variety and salmon sashimi. The imitation wasabi was questionable because of the unnaturally bright green color, but still tasted ok. I ate a ton of it and didn't get sick. Check mark! I thought the place was relatively clean, for a buffet. The table surface was a bit spotty, but I thought it was ok after a wipe. Note that they charge $5 for kids, even at 18 month and 4 years old. It's fair, considering they make a mess and it's just $5. If you are hungry and wanting to stuff your face in a Super fashion, this place may be your calling. Overall, this is exactly what you imagine when you think "Chinese Buffet". With the right expectations and hungry stomach, it'll be a satisfying experience.

    So my son really wanted to come here for his 5th birthday. So we had a party of about 15 and they had a table set up for us since we called prior to arriving. I'm not sure if I just hadn't been to a buffet in many, many years, but this was lowkey a pretty good experience for us. Nothing fancy here, but a pretty good variety and the place was humming while we were there from about 6:30 - 8:30. The food was pretty tasty but the service was a bit lacking. The place is decently clean but I do wish it was better lit. At least the area where we were sitting it was very dim as the sun went down. If I were craving a buffet, I would probably come back. For $15.99 per adult, $8.99 for kids 4 to 9 (and under 4'10") and $3.99 for 3 and under, it's a pretty good deal. My family and other relatives were pleasantly surprised.

    I had the Chinese broccoli with beef chow fun here, and the food was excellent. The dish had great…read more"wok hei," showing impressive wok cooking skill that kept the food hot for a long time. In my experience, beef chow fun at other restaurants often suffers from soggy rice noodles, uneven flavoring, and noodles that stick together. Most notably, other places often use excessive oil that pools at the bottom of the plate. As you can see in the attached pictures, the flavor here was very even, and the texture was firm without being chewy. Each noodle was clearly separated, and there was almost no oil pooling at the bottom. Having eaten Chinese and Vietnamese food my entire life, I strongly recommend this place.

    I walked up to the counter to order. Lady asked if it's take out or eat in. I replied to eat here…read more She said to sit down and order from the table. She brought water and menus. On the table was a holder with chopsticks, soup spoons and napkins. It was a chilly, blustery day - I so enjoyed the Henan-style lamb with noodles soup! Three kinds of noodles: wide, hand-pulled with a nice chew; thin, textured tofu; crystal. Happy with the two quail eggs. There was a nice amount of wood ear fungus, kelp? and fresh cilantro. The lamb was tender and the broth flavorful. I saved half of the soup for dinner and chowed down on the pork bun. It was hot and toasty from the bun being grilled. Had to eat it right away as the bun was crispy crunchy and the sauce inside will eventually make the bottom mushy. "Yum!"

    Was in the sugarland area to study and stopped by Xing's Kitchen for dinner. They are a food…read morestall/restaurant inside of the jusgo market. They have only about 5 tables inside and 1 outside. I wanted to keep it simple and got the shanxi oil noodle. It's been awhile since I've had chili oil hand pulled noodles. The wait was about 10-15 minutes for the food. It came out hot and the aroma of garlic hits you hard. They have chili oil and vinegar available at the table if you want to add some to your food. I thought it was solid and it is actually enough for 2 meals to be honest. Noodles were chewy and soak up all the chili oil and garlic flavor. It's a bit oily, there's a puddle at the end but I'd say it's pretty solid. I would say that northern pasta edges this one out just a bit for best chili oil noodles in Houston tho
